Tricks to keep your React site Mobile Friendly. In this tutorial, I’m going to show you how simple and easy it can be to code a fully responsive and fluid email template.This isn’t complicated or intimidating at all. Multiple page website design. No they represent much more than that. Secondly, it has a clean code development which makes it possible for you to engage it as an SCSS mixin library or CSS framework. If you love mobile-first designs, responsive designs, or if you want your app to scale up and down depending on screen size while retaining its structural integrity, then react-responsive is the package for you. The first principle of responsive design is called mobile first. Category: CSS. Responsive web design uses only HTML and CSS. helps you to build quality websites quickly and it is one of the most reliable frameworks. Il n'y aura pas … I can’t pinpoint exactly what made me change the way I write my course.header.alt.is_video. Unlike responsive design, mobile-first is about a complete mobile user-experience: adapted app-like user-interface, less text, larger fonts, fast download speed, video and audio, one call-to-action per page, short forms, etcetera. 1. For the past five years, mobile has dominated desktop as the most popular form of digital media access. This is the best way to ensure both versions work. Desktop computer and cell phone users alike all benefit from responsive websites. In this tutorial, we will learn all the fundamental concepts of Pure CSS, how to use it to create a faster, attractive, and responsive website design. Responsive Web Design with HTML5 and CSS3, Second Edition is an updated and improved guide that responds to the latest challenges and trends in web design, giving you access to the most effective approaches to modern responsive design. Bootstrap: It is the most popular framework that is growing rapidly and available freely to the user. Nathan B Hankes Jan 12 ・4 min read. Google's algorithms should be able to automatically detect this setup if all Googlebot user agents are allowed to crawl the page and its assets (CSS, JavaScript, and images). Length: 8 min read. Master Responsive Web Design CSS Grid, Flexbox & Animations Course. Responsive Web Design CSS HTML UI Design Media Queries Navigation Design. How to Develop and Test a Mobile-First Design ... - CSS-Tricks Responsive design is an emerging technique with cool new trends every year. There’s something we can all learn from Google’s upcoming mobile-first shifts: Going on, due to its architectural design, basis has a grid system and a vertical rhythm. Voici une manière simple d'ajouter un affichage Responsive Web Design (version Mobile) tout en conservant l'affichage, si souhaité, de la version Desktop pour mobiles/tablettes en Desktop First. Because your web designs will be viewed on screens ranging from an old iPhone to a 27" iMac and beyond, you'll often encounter design situations where the website will require two or more designs in order to look nice and remain … From a design standpoint, responsive web design is a combination of moveable grids, layouts and images that function from CSS media queries. So when the user is looking at a website on their phone and then moves to a desktop, they have a similar experience due to the flexibility of the layout. Below image shows the responsive structure of web pages. Chapter 8 Responsive CSS. One Last Thing. Mobile Responsive Design —an Overview and CSS Techniques. Bootstrap’s Responsive Breakpoints As one of the first, and most popular, responsive frameworks, Bootstrap led the assault on static web design and helped establish mobile-first design as an industry standard. A website clone of an article from the New York Times website. For the purposes of this tutorial, I included a CSS-reset at the top of the sheet just for simplicity. When you first create or re-create your website, you don’t have to choose between a mobile-first or responsive design. For the year 2017, the number of mobile users is expected to reach 4.7 billion and 58.9% of those users will be using their mobile to access the internet. This article and demowill go over the following: There is even more up to date responsive guidance on our new Web Fundamentalssite. Responsive design provides the highest possible level of user experience on mobile devices, so being mobile friendly just doesn’t cut it anymore, and will certainly not cut it in another two years. CSS Media Queries are used to make Responsive Web Design and you are going to learn everything in this tutorial. Why mobile-first is easier Websites are naturally responsive before we even write a single line of CSS. We will know how to deal with responsive images A Mobile-first Approach to Responsive Web Design. Hamburger Button to Close Icon Tutorial: https://www.youtube.com/watch?v=uugicVDUzMANew to CSS Grid? Justinmind’s wireframe tool new responsive features make creating a website that’s mobile first a cakewalk. It is easy to learn & develop. Apprenez à créer votre site web avec HTML5 et CSS3 > Utilisez le responsive design avec les Media Queries Apprenez à créer votre site web avec HTML5 et CSS3. Responsive React. Web Design. What I mean with that is that your mobile views are usually much simpler and thus require less CSS. Mobile-First Design. Responsive web design is focused around providing an intuitive and gratifying experience for everyone. In simple words, Mobile First Responsive Design is a way of designing websites for Smaller Screens, and then progressively adjusts your design for devices with larger screens using CSS Media Queries. Mobile First Responsive Design. 10 years ago, around 2010-2012, we saw a huge change with mobile and responsive design, and the emergence of CSS3. Mobile first. Well, the term Responsive Web Design is often known as checking the browser on multiple viewport widths and device sizes. Firstly, the basis is responsive and mobile first. This approach feels easy since websites are usually developed and tested on desktops, and follows from the software principle of graceful degradation (systems should maintain functionality as portions break down, such as the “capability” of having screen real estate). Different page designs using CSS Grid. First, we need to fill in responsive.html ’s element with some empty boxes. Instead, the former is actually a design strategy (mobile-first), while the latter is the result of a technical approach (responsive). Category: CSS. CSS3 Flexbox Layout. Developing for mobile is an exercise in constraints. CSS-Only Dark Menu By John Urbank. Stylesheets are the main tool in responsive web design (RWD) implementation. Avec cette modification, il n'est plus possible d'afficher la version Desktop sur mobiles/tablettes ou fenêtre rétrécis. Websites in this day and age must cater to an ever growing market of mobile users on top of … Length: 8 min read. a responsive portfolio website. CSS3 Grid Layout. Learn CSS Transitions & Rotations. Desktop styles tend to be more complex By: Joshua Johnson. Si vous voulez faire un site spécialement pour les mobiles et dont la détection plante la moitié du temps, libre à vous. Responsive design is often framed as a technique to “make it also work on mobile”. React provides to your Frontend a Simple, Stateless & Declarative Component architecture that keeps your app easy to … The Basic … you probably won't use jquery mobile if you are supporting desktop screens too. CSS components to reuse Buttons, Cards. Mar. These useful snippets are perfect for designers to seize and use as a launchpad for other web projects. Outils CSS pour le responsive design. Responsive Design Jake Rocheleau • May 22, 2017 • 7 minutes READ . Getting started with react-responsive First, begin by creating a new React project with no dependencies. I love the striped border and dark color scheme paired with this menu. Philosophically: Optimizing the experience for mobile users as much as possible. 13. Instead, the former is actually a design strategy (mobile-first), while the latter is the result of a technical approach (responsive). If a business develops its website, the design is often based on the assumption that visitors will browse it on a desktop computer. Desktop layouts are typically more complex than their mobile counterparts, and this “mobile-first” approach maximizes the amount of CSS that you can reuse across your layouts. The problem is that, our design dictates that the left sidebar should be on the left at full size, but with this code it will render in the center. Mobile First est un concept de Web design optimisé pour le mobile. Learn the Mobile First approach to building websites. First off, CSS units are what developers use to determine the size of a property, such as their length, width, font size, etc. Why we need to create mobile-first, responsive, adaptive experiences 2. Overview. Media queries are an important part of responsive web design commonly used for grid layouts, font sizes, margins, and padding that differ between screen size and orientation. CSS Animations. Content is the most important aspect of any site. ... i really like this idea/direction. 31, 2017. Here's why and how a mobile first design should be your priority in 2019. It has easy customization styles with selected simple theme variables and can customize the look of the elements with 100% control on the visual variables. Syed examines some neat little responsive design tips from Bootstrap's CSS. CSS3 Grid Layout; CSS Transitions, Translations, rotations; CSS @keyframes ; CSS Animations; @media queries for Desktop, Tablet and Mobile design Mobile First Approach; CSS3 Variables; Real Life Projects, Projects, Project….. Then we will build a ton of Projects together: a simple but elegant restaurant website. If you build mobile first, you're building up your CSS in complexity. Global styles, those not inside media queries, are focussed on … CSS in responsive design. CSS3 Flexbox Layout. Luke Wroblewski first introduced the term “ Mobile first ” to the Web World in 2009. milligram css html framework css-framework design minimalist flexbox amp bootstrap css3 front-end html5 kickstarter less responsive mobile mobile-first postcss sass scss stylus propeller - Propeller - Develop more, Code less Mis à jour le 04/01/2021 . Create your content and structure. Le Responsive Design ou plus précisément le Responsive Web Design (RWD) est une technique de conception d’interface digitale qui fait en sorte que l’affichage d’une quelconque page d’un site s’adapte de façon automatique à la taille de l’écran du terminal qui le lit. em here is the CSS unit used, which refers to the size of the text. Adaptive design, on the other hand, uses static layouts based on breakpoints which don’t respond once they’re loaded. With it, you can create columns and rows for quick and easy layouts. Content, design and performance are necessary across all devices to ensure usability and satisfaction. course.header.alt.is_certifying J'ai tout compris ! YouTubeMockplus Cloud - Collaboration and design handoff for product teams. Get Started for Free. What attractive in design:… 2. The first step is to put viewport meta tag inside your page head area. This topic describes the mechanisms and approaches to building RWD used in the default Magento themes. It encompasses a number of CSS and HTML features and techniques and is now essentially just how we build websites by default. Responsive. Master Responsive Web Design CSS Grid, Flexbox & Animations Course. Responsive Design Mobile screens to 5K monitors, get all viewports in one overview. Responsive height design, seriously? They almost always have just a single column, and lack many of the additional flourishes you have space for on larger screens. Designing the website layout is always the first step. In this stage, you don’t have to think of a responsive design yet. Just focus on building the website layout. You can use a website layout template or use a prototyping tool to quickly finish the skeleton of your website. This is where you make your website responsive. It contains CSS- and JavaScript-based design templates for typography, forms, buttons, navigation, and other interface components. The good news is, the ecosystem is changing, and it's changing pretty rapidly. Another, even simpler, way is to use a library like Skeleton CSS. Below is an example of a common use case of mobile first styling in which a column is … In responsive design everything (for all devices) gets send (from the server to the client). Downloadable source code for all of the videos and projects. Responsive design refers to a site or application design that responds to the environment in which it is viewed. Mobile First means designing for mobile before designing for desktop or any other device (This will make the page display faster on smaller devices). The full CSS sheet can be found in the source code for this tutorial. Mobile-first web design means designing the mobile website first and working up to the desktop version. Which means my CSS, without any media query, is going to design for the mobile portrait use case, and then adding breakpoints I’ll design for devices that are bigger and bigger, banning the max-width from media queries. One way is to use Bootstrap, a popular HTML, CSS, and JS framework for developing responsive, mobile-first projects for the web. Applying CSS Media Queries. Basic HTML. Ces dernières permet de cibler du CSS spécifiquement à une taille d’écran. These days the majority of people accessing any web site you build will be using a device with a small screen, such as a mobile phone. CSS is evolving, and a new era of responsive design is right on the horizon. 8.1 Mobile-First Design. It was developed with a mobile-first concept and uses responsive elements that fit on all device sizes. Most web designers know about mobile-first design and how it has dramatically affected responsive design.But there is another technique that may be less popular but can solve problems in a clearer fashion. Designing For The Best Experience For All Users Web pages can be viewed using many different devices: desktops, tablets, and phones. All You Need to Know: Mobile First Approach vs. So let’s design for the content and not let the design dictate the content. Web Design. 1. Responsive web design (RWD) is an approach to web design that makes web pages render well on a variety of devices and window or screen sizes from minimum to maximum display size. Learn CSS Transitions & Rotations. Navbar with logo and bars icon. Bootstrap is responsive and since version 3 is now mobile first. Every utility class in Tailwind can be applied conditionally at different breakpoints, which makes it a piece of cake to build complex responsive interfaces without ever leaving your HTML. It is more user-friendly than another framework because it’s based on web development languages like HTML, CSS, and jquery, which helps to make web pages more responsive. Requirements. Mobile-first responsive web design requires overhauling a site’s foundation and more importantly requires a mental overhaul. Tachyons. As a result, many designers to this … The new size attribute allows you to define an element’s position by pixels as well as by percentage. But phones come in a wide range of sizes and resolutions, and many people will still access that same site from a laptop or desktop with a much larger monitor (as well as other capabilities, such as a mouse instead of a touchscreen). A user experience survey published by the Nielson/Norman Group… It is responsive and has mobile-first block element styles, full viewport breakpoint coverage that makes responsive web interface development easier. Let’s refer to this example: Observe the third line of the code. The support to build amazing websites. Responsive and mobile ready design. If you build mobile first, you're building up your CSS in complexity. Alexandre Niveau. By default, it supports to mobile-first design. Instead of changing styles when the width gets smaller than 768px, we should change the design when the width gets larger than 768px. Historically, most web designers and their clients have approached the desktop side of any project first, while leaving the mobile part as a secondary goal that gets accomplished later. 5 Answers5. Explication de la conception Mobile-First Lorsque vous vous lancez dans votre aventure pour recréer votre site Web, il n’est pas nécessaire de choisir tout de suite entre le design mobile-first ou responsive. Thus it will remain the same width of the screen size. In this topic . Each box has an image in it so we can tell them apart a little bit easier. What attractive in design: Convenient scroll navigation. The core difference between responsive design and adaptive design is that adaptive design sends only the by a specific device needed elements and content to the device. Mais sachez que vous pouvez vous en passer : le responsive design et les media queries rendent votre page lisible sur tous les écrans. Adding design elements to make it responsive and look good across all devices. We see this happen about every 10 years. Responsive web design is not a program or a JavaScript. Mobile first responsive we… This means exactly what it sounds like: you should build your mobile layout before you build your “desktop” design. Responsive React. Mobile-first est une stratégie de conception, tandis que la conception réactive est le résultat d’une approche plus technique. Recent work also considers the viewer proximity as part of the viewing context as an extension for RWD. The skills you’ve learned in this desktop-first tutorial are also applicable to mobile-first.From a technical point of view, there are two small differences with mobile-first design:. CSS Animations. Responsive Design. To re-use them in your custom theme, make your theme inherit from the Magento Blank theme. A Framework helps the quick development of the project. Mobile-first responsive web design requires overhauling a site’s foundation and more importantly requires a mental overhaul. Mobile first and responsive web design aren’t simply two great tastes that go great together. Adding Google Fonts. Flexible Grid demo ni détection de navigateur est très avantageux : plus simple à maintenir, moins lourd pour vos visiteurs, et techniquement plus fiable (pas de détection foireuse des navigateurs).